Company Overview:

DELOS is an aquaculture technology company combining operational expertise, scientific understanding, and technological adoption to support Indonesian enterprise shrimp farms aiming to improve nationwide productivity and supply chain integration. Indonesia as a maritime country has the potential to give birth to the next global aquaculture champion.

As we continue to deepen our farming and downstream operations in offering an ever-growing array of products and services, we are happy to announce that we are seeking a dedicated Quality Assurance Manager. This role is vital to ensuring the health and success of a cycle, preventing the spread of diseases, and maintaining compliance with company and industry regulations. Responsibilities:

Biosecurity Program Development:

  • Create and implement comprehensive biosecurity protocols to safeguard the cycle from diseases and contaminants.
  • Regularly review and update biosecurity plans to align with current industry standards and regulatory requirements.

Risk Management:

  • Conduct regular risk assessments to identify and mitigate potential biosecurity threats.
  • Develop contingency plans and response strategies for disease outbreaks or contamination incidents.

Monitoring & Surveillance:

  • Oversee the monitoring of shrimp health, water quality, and environmental conditions to detect early signs of disease or contamination.
  • Implement effective surveillance systems to ensure continuous biosecurity.

Training & Education:

  • Design and deliver training programs for staff on biosecurity practices and protocols.
  • Promote a culture of biosecurity awareness, responsibility, and monitoring among all employees.

Regulatory Compliance:

  • Ensure the company's operations comply with local, national, and international biosecurity regulations.
  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of relevant laws and guidelines, and ensure company practices are in full compliance.

Incident Management:

  • Lead the response to biosecurity incidents.
  • Document and report incidents and oversee corrective actions to prevent future occurrences.

Continuous Improvement:

  • Stay informed of the latest research and technological advances in aquaculture biosecurity.
  • Propose and implement improvements to enhance the effectiveness of biosecurity measures.

Reporting:

  • Prepare detailed reports on biosecurity activities, incidents, and compliance for senior management.
  • Maintain accurate records of all biosecurity-related activities and assessments.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in aquaculture, marine biology, environmental science, or a related field. A master’s degree is a plus.
  • 5+ years of experience in aquaculture biosecurity, disease management, or similar fields, preferably in shrimp farming or related industries, and 1-2 years' experience in handling team
  • Proven track record of developing and implementing biosecurity protocols in line with industry standards.
  • Ability to work in dynamic environments and under pressure, particularly in managing biosecurity incidents.
  • Proven experience in continuous improvement processes and implementing the latest biosecurity advancements.
